Spain - Export of Crude Groundnut Oil
Since 2013, Spain Export of Crude Groundnut Oil fell by 37.1% year on year. At $755.64 in 2018, the country was ranked number 43 comparing other countries in Export of Crude Groundnut Oil. Spain is overtaken by Philippines, which was ranked number 42 at $787 and is followed by Uganda at $633. Senegal lead the ranking with $70,495,024 in 2019, an increase of 64.6% versus 2018. Argentina, Brazil and Nicaragua resp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kuwait witnessed the best average annual growth at +500.4% per year, while Guatemala was the worst growing country at -71.3% per year.
